Introduction
Timothy J McQuillen is an accomplished inventor based in Westfield, IN (US). He holds two patents that showcase his innovative contributions to the fields of roofing and solar technology. His work reflects a commitment to enhancing safety and efficiency in these industries.
Latest Patents
One of McQuillen's latest patents is for polyolefin thermoplastic roofing membranes with improved burn resistivity. This invention features a multi-layered thermoplastic roofing membrane that includes a top layer with magnesium hydroxide dispersed within a thermoplastic resin, an upper middle layer with magnesium hydroxide and calcium carbonate, and a lower layer also containing these materials. This design aims to improve the fire resistance of roofing materials.
Another significant patent is for a solar panel assembly with movable barriers. This assembly includes a solar panel that is spaced from a surface to create a gap, along with a barrier that can move between open and closed positions. The barrier is designed to inhibit airflow through the gap when in the closed position, particularly in response to fire detection. This innovation allows for normal airflow during operation while enhancing safety in the event of a fire.
Career Highlights
Throughout his career, McQuillen has worked with notable companies such as Firestone Building Products Company, LLC and Holcim Technology Ltd. His experience in these organizations has contributed to his expertise in developing innovative solutions in building materials and renewable energy technologies.
